"10 Умных Хитростей и Библиотек Python, Которые Упрост

10 Умных Хитростей и Библиотек Python, Которые Упростят Вашу Жизнь
Привет, программисты! Если вы когда-нибудь задумывались, как сделать свою жизнь проще (и, возможно, даже немного веселее), то вы попали по адресу! Вот 10 хитростей и библиотек Python, которые помогут вам в этом нелегком деле. Давайте начнем!
NumPy – ваш лучший друг в мире чисел!
Забудьте о бесконечных циклах и сложных вычислениях. NumPy сделает все за вас. Просто не забудьте сказать ему "спасибо", когда он решит ваши проблемы с производительностью!Pandas – для тех, кто любит данные.
Если ваши данные выглядят так, будто их собрали на свалке, Pandas поможет вам их упорядочить. Это как уборка в квартире, только без необходимости выбрасывать старые носки.Matplotlib – графики, которые не стыдно показать маме.
Создавайте красивые графики и визуализации. И помните: если ваш график не выглядит как искусство, вы просто не достаточно старались!Requests – делаем HTTP-запросы проще.
Забудьте о сложных библиотеках! Requests – это как волшебная палочка для работы с API. Просто не забудьте, что волшебство иногда требует аутентификации.Beautiful Soup – для тех, кто любит "погружаться" в HTML.
Если вам нужно извлечь данные с веб-страниц, это ваша библиотека. Она сделает это так легко, что вы почувствуете себя шеф-поваром на кулинарном шоу.Flask – создаем веб-приложения с минимальными усилиями.
Flask – это как легкий завтрак: просто, быстро и без лишних калорий. Идеально подходит для тех, кто не хочет тратить время на сложные фреймворки.SQLAlchemy – для тех, кто не любит писать SQL.
Если вы предпочитаете работать с базами данных, не погружаясь в SQL, SQLAlchemy – это то, что вам нужно. Это как общение с базой данных на языке любви (или, по крайней мере, на языке Python).Turtle – для тех, кто хочет научиться программировать, играя.
Да, это библиотека для рисования! Если вы когда-либо мечтали стать художником, но не умеете держать кисть, Turtle поможет вам создать шедевры с помощью кода.pytest – потому что тестирование – это весело!
Если вы не любите тестировать свой код, то, возможно, вы просто не знаете, как это делать правильно. pytest сделает тестирование легким и даже увлекательным! (Ну, почти.)Jupyter Notebook – ваш интерактивный помощник.
Это как ваш личный блокнот, только он позволяет вам запускать код прямо в нем. Идеально подходит для тех, кто любит делиться своими мыслями (и ошибками) с миром.
Вот и все! Эти хитрости и библиотеки помогут вам сделать вашу работу проще и, возможно, даже немного веселее. Помните: программирование – это не только работа, но и искусство. Удачи вам, и пусть ваш код всегда компилируется с первого раза!

All images are taken from the Pixabay.comБольше полезных статей 4adm.in
